//////////////////////////////////////////////////////////////////////
        /// <summary>Creates a shipping object given a shipping attribute.
        /// </summary>
        /// <exception cref="ArgumentException">If the attribute
        /// type is not 'shipping' or unknown</exception>
        /// <exception cref="FormatException">If the attribute contains
        /// invalid sub-elements or lacks required sub-elements</exception>
        //////////////////////////////////////////////////////////////////////
        public Shipping(GBaseAttribute attribute)
        {
            GBaseAttributeType type = attribute.Type;

            if (type != null && type != GBaseAttributeType.Shipping)
            {
                throw new ArgumentException("Expected an attribute of " +
                                            "type 'shipping', got an attribute of type '" + type + "'");
            }
            this.country = GetRequiredAttribute(attribute, "country");
            this.service = GetRequiredAttribute(attribute, "service");
            string priceString = GetRequiredAttribute(attribute, "price");

            try
            {
                FloatUnit priceUnit = new FloatUnit(priceString);
                this.price    = priceUnit.Value;
                this.currency = priceUnit.Unit;
            }
            catch (FormatException)
            {
                this.price    = NumberFormat.ToFloat(priceString);
                this.currency = null;
            }
        }
 //////////////////////////////////////////////////////////////////////
 /// <summary>Extracts location information from an attribute.
 /// </summary>
 /// <exception cref="FormatException">If the attribute contains
 /// invalid sub-elements or lacks required sub-elements</exception>
 //////////////////////////////////////////////////////////////////////
 public Location(GBaseAttribute attribute)
 {
     this.address = attribute.Content;
     if (attribute["latitude"] != null && attribute["longitude"] != null)
     {
         this.latitude       = NumberFormat.ToFloat(attribute["latitude"]);
         this.longitude      = NumberFormat.ToFloat(attribute["longitude"]);
         this.hasCoordinates = true;
     }
 }
